Int’l Women’s Day: Am Proud Of Nigerian Women, Says Gbajabiamila’s wife

The wife of the Speaker of the House of Representatives, Salamatu Gbajabiamila, has celebrated Nigerian women on the occasion of the International Women’s Day over their resilience over the years.

Mrs Gbajabiamila said she was proud of Nigerian women and paid glowing tributes to them, calling for the elimination of inequity and injustice that women encounter in their daily dealings.

“On this year’s International Women’s Day, we celebrate the strength, resilience and achievements of women all over the world.

“At the same time, we acknowledge the challenges we face in the different spheres of our lives and rededicate ourselves to conquering those challenges so each new generation of women can live better and more fulfilled lives than the generation before.”

She said the theme of this year’s International Women’s Day, #ChooseToChallenge, “is a call to service and a mandate to go forth and build a better world for women and humanity.

“As we delight in the hard-won achievements of today, let us prepare ourselves to do all that we can to eliminate from our world the vestiges of inequity and injustice that still too often stand in the way of women achieving their dreams.”

The Speaker’s wife honoured the women who live the spirit of this year’s theme every day and paid tribute to those who strive to do so despite significant obstacles.

“I rejoice in the memory of the women who paved the way, who made sacrifices that made today’s achievements possible. And I applaud all the women and girls who continue to work hard to make their mark in this world in every way possible.
